Quarterly Planning Note — Divestiture of the Coastal Tooling Unit

For the finance team: the sale of the Coastal Tooling unit to Pellmark Industries remains on track for close in Q3. Please finalize the carve-out balance sheet, reconcile intercompany positions, and prepare the working-capital adjustment schedule by month-end. Audit support requests should be prioritized. For planning purposes, note the following sensitive item:

internal memo for hawef-kahif: The finance team signed off on a budget of $25.9 million for Project Sorox. The renewal with Pelokek Logistics closes at $51.7 million a year, 52 percent below the last contract.

# Break-Glass: Catalog Cache Invalidation

Scope: the Pinrow product catalog at Veldstone Retail. If stale prices persist after a purge and the Hollowmere invalidation queue is wedged, use break-glass to flush the edge tier directly. Contractors: get verbal sign-off from the catalog lead first. Steps: open the Hollowmere admin shell, select emergency-flush, confirm the tenant, and run it once — repeated flushes thrash the origin. Access is logged and expires after 20 minutes. Unseal the admin shell with the passphrase below.

recovery phrase for kahop-tajog: istix-casvan

Q4 Planning Note — Branch Managers

We are submitting a budget request for three additional service technicians and one mobile repair van covering the Osterby and Winmere branches. Approval expected by mid-November. Do not commit overtime beyond current limits until the request clears. Hiring, if approved, starts January. Questions go through Regional Ops. The justification we're putting forward is summarised below.

confidential, yawif-fadup: The southern region missed its Eliius quota by 61.1 percent last quarter. Istixax Freight plans to raise the Jorwyn list price by 65.7 percent in October. The board signed off on a budget of $445.3 million for Project Ulaox. The renewal with Briathax Partners closes at $41.0 million a year, 49.9 percent below the last contract.